Mashed Potato Waffle, Crispy Turkey, Smashed Avocado, Cranberry and Brie Melts
Prep 15 min Cook 15 min Serves 4 Source

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 cups leftover mashed potatoes
  • 1 cup buttermilk
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/4 cup butter (melted)
  • 4-5 leaves sage (minced)
  • 1 cup fl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 cup parmesan cheese (grated)
  • leftover turkey (enough for 4 triangles)
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 1 avocado (lightly mashed)
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• 4 ounces brie (sliced (or more!))
  • leftover cranberry sauce
  • 8 slices cooked thick cut bacon (optional)
  • 4 eggs (cooked to your liking (optional))

Steps

  1. 1

    To make the waffles. In a medium bowl whisk together the mashed potatoes, buttermilk, eggs and melted butter until smooth. Stir in the minced sage.

  2. 2

    Add the flour, baking soda and baking powder and stir until just combined. Fold in the parmesan cheese.

  3. 3

    Preheat waffle iron. When ready scoop the batter (you will need to spread the batter out using the back of a spoon) into the hot, greased waffle maker and cook to your preference. Repeat with the remaining batter. The batter should make about 4-5 waffles, depending on you waffle maker. Tear 2 of those waffles into fourths. If you are using a square waffles just leave them whole.

  4. 4

    Prep the sandwiches. Heat a skillet over medium heat and melt the butter. Once hot add the turkey and get it buttery and crisp all over, about 5 minutes. Remove from the heat

  5. 5

    Add the avocado to a bowl and lightly mash with a pinch of salt and pepper.

  6. 6

    Assemble the sandwiches. Preheat the oven to 425 degree F. Line a baking sheet with parchment and place the waffles on the baking sheet.

  7. 7

    Spread the mashed avocado on four of the waffle triangles (or squares or whatever shape you have). Top with sliced brie, then the warm buttery turkey, a dollop of cranberry sauce and two slices of bacon (if using). Now grab the tops to the sandwiches (the remaining four triangles) and add a slice or two of brie. Place the pan in the oven for 5 minutes, watching closely to make sure the brie is not getting too melty! During this time I fried my eggs.

  8. 8

    Remove from the oven and top each triangle with one egg and then place the tops on the sandwiches. Push down and eat!! FYI, it is going to be a bit messy. We had to use a fork for these!
